Advancements in Robotics
One major advancement in dental surgery is using robotic innovation, which enables accurate and reliable surgical procedures. These robot systems are geared up with innovative imaging technology and exact tools that allow doctors to navigate via intricate anatomical structures effortlessly. By using robot modern technology, cosmetic surgeons can attain higher medical precision, leading to improved patient outcomes and faster recovery times.
On top of that, using robotics in dental surgery permits minimally invasive treatments, lowering the injury to surrounding cells and promoting faster recovery.

Minimally Invasive Methods
To even more advance the area of dental surgery, embrace the capacity of minimally intrusive strategies that can greatly profit both cosmetic surgeons and clients alike.
Minimally invasive methods are reinventing the area by decreasing surgical injury, lessening post-operative discomfort, and speeding up the healing process. These methods include making use of smaller sized lacerations and specialized tools to carry out treatments with precision and efficiency.
By making use of sophisticated imaging modern technology, such as cone beam of light computed tomography (CBCT), specialists can properly intend and implement surgical treatments with marginal invasiveness.
Furthermore, making use of lasers in oral surgery allows for precise tissue cutting and coagulation, resulting in reduced blood loss and decreased healing time.
With minimally intrusive strategies, patients can experience much faster recuperation, reduced scarring, and enhanced outcomes, making it a crucial facet of the future of oral surgery.
